Parse and render SVG vector graphics (CentOS 7.9.2009)
The librsvg library is a lightweight library for parsing and rendering vector-graphic files in SVG format (like the ones made by sodipodi). It also includes functions that render anti-aliased fonts using freetype, including caching of glyphs. It is used by Nautilus for drawing vector icons and anti-aliased text.
